WebJul 15, 2024 · How to prevent access to Command Prompt in Windows 11 using Registry Editor? Although the Group Policy Editor is the best method to apply a policy on a Windows PC, it is not part of the Windows 11 Home edition. Therefore, you must use Registry Editor to apply a policy on your Windows 11 Home computer if you use it. Solution 3: Windows Console settings WebSep 26, 2008 · This little command-line applet takes a registry path and makes Regedit open to that path. It accepts root keys in standard (e.g. H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E) and abbreviated form (e.g. HKLM). WebNov 1, 2001 · Regedit provides command-line options you can use to export and import REG files. To use them, click Run on the Start menu, and then type regedit followed by any of the options you want to use. These command-line options are also suitable to use at the MS-DOS command prompt or within batch files. If you have a command that you want …
